2. Google My Business Optimization
An integral part of local SEO success is optimizing Google My Business (GMB) profiles. Trades businesses should claim and verify their GMB listing, ensuring that business information, including address, phone number, and business hours, is accurate. A well-optimized GMB profile not only enhances visibility in local searches but also provides essential information for customers.
3. Cultivating Positive Local Reviews
Local SEO thrives on positive customer reviews. Encouraging satisfied clients to leave reviews on platforms like Google, Yelp, or industry-specific review sites not only boosts credibility but also influences local search rankings. Trades businesses should actively manage and respond to reviews, showcasing their commitment to customer satisfaction.
4. Targeting Local Keywords
Crafting content with a focus on local keywords is pivotal for trades businesses. By incorporating location-specific terms into website content, meta tags, and headers, businesses signal their relevance to local search queries, increasing the likelihood of appearing in localized search results.

7. Local Link Building
Building local citations and acquiring backlinks from local websites and directories contribute to the overall authority and relevance of a trades business in local searches. This strengthens the business's online presence and further establishes its connection to the local community.
